Request Access Link

To manage your recurring donations, you'll need to request a secure access link. This ensures your subscription information stays private and secure.

  • Visit the donation page on our website
  • Scroll to "Manage Your Subscriptions" section
  • Enter your email address (the one associated with your account)
  • Click "Send Link"
  • Check your email for the secure link (valid for 24 hours)
  • If multiple accounts exist, select which one to manage

View & Manage Subscriptions

Once you access the subscription management page, you can view and manage all your subscriptions in one place.

  • View Active Subscriptions: See amount, billing day, next payment date, and status
  • Track Payment Plans: Monitor progress with payment counters (e.g., "Payment 3 of 6")
  • Edit Amount: Change monthly donation amount (regular subscriptions only)
  • Change Billing Day: Update when payments are charged
  • Set End Date: Schedule when subscription should stop
  • Cancel: Stop subscription immediately or at period end
  • Retry Payment: Update payment info if a payment fails

Payment Plans Checkout Feature

When making a donation through the public campaign, or via a pledge invoice that was sent to you, you can split your donation into 2-12 monthly payments using a payment plan.

  • During checkout, choose "Payment Plan" instead of "Pay in Full"
  • Select 2-12 monthly payments
  • Pick billing day (5th or 20th of the month)
  • Review complete payment schedule with specific dates
  • Prorated First Payment: May be adjusted based on days until billing day
  • Fixed Schedule: Cannot be edited once created
  • Automatically completes after final payment

Understanding Subscription Types

Subscriptions allow you to set up recurring monthly donations that are automatically charged to your payment method. You have full control over the amount, billing day, and duration.

🔄 Regular Recurring Subscription

A standard monthly donation that continues indefinitely or until a specified end date. Perfect for ongoing support.

  • Choose any amount (minimum $1.00)
  • Select your preferred billing day (1st-28th of the month)
  • Set an optional end date or keep it ongoing
  • Can be edited or cancelled at any time

📅 Payment Plan Limited Duration

Split a larger donation into 2-12 equal monthly payments. Ideal for pledges or specific commitments.

  • Choose total amount and number of payments (2-12 months)
  • Select billing day (5th or 20th of the month)
  • First payment may be prorated based on days until billing day
  • Automatically ends after all payments are complete
  • Cannot be edited once created (only retry failed payments)

Payment Application Options

When creating a subscription, you can choose how payments should be applied to your account. This gives you flexibility in managing your donations and outstanding balances.

💰 Apply to Outstanding Balance

Subscription payments will first be applied to any outstanding balance on your account, with any remaining amount recorded as a new donation.

  • Helps you pay down existing pledges automatically
  • Reduces your balance each month
  • Excess amount becomes a new donation
  • Great for members with ongoing commitments

🎁 New Donation Only

The entire subscription payment is recorded as a new donation, separate from any existing balance.

  • All payments are fresh donations
  • Does not affect existing balance
  • Ideal for additional support beyond commitments
  • Perfect for general fund contributions

Payment Plan Features

📊 Prorated First Payment

If you create a payment plan between billing days, your first payment will be prorated to cover the partial month. This ensures fair billing and aligns future payments with your chosen billing day.

  • Example: If you select the 20th and sign up on the 10th, you'll pay for 10 days today
  • All subsequent payments will be the full monthly amount
  • Total amount remains the same - just distributed fairly

🔒 Fixed Payment Plans

Payment plans cannot be edited once created. This ensures the commitment is honored as agreed.

  • Amount and schedule are locked in
  • Can retry failed payments
  • Automatically completes after final payment
  • Progress tracked with payment counter

Tips & Best Practices

Consent Required: Before creating your first subscription, you'll need to review and accept our terms for storing payment information. This is a one-time requirement for security and transparency.
Billing Day Selection: Choose a billing day that aligns with your budget. For regular subscriptions, you can pick any day from the 1st to 28th. Payment plans offer the 5th or 20th for consistency.
Payment Plan vs Regular Subscription: Use payment plans for specific commitments with a defined end date. Use regular subscriptions for ongoing support that you want to continue indefinitely.
Failed Payments: If a payment fails (expired card, insufficient funds, etc.), you'll see a "Retry Payment" button. This creates a secure checkout session to update your payment method and retry the charge.
Cancellation Options: When cancelling a regular subscription, you can choose to cancel immediately or at the end of the current billing period. Payment plans cannot be cancelled but will automatically end after the final payment.
Email Notifications: You'll receive email confirmations when subscriptions are created, when payments are processed, and when payment plans are completed. Keep these for your records.
Security: Access links expire after 24 hours. If your link expires, simply request a new one from the donation page. Never share your access link with others.
Processing Fees: You can choose to cover processing fees when creating subscriptions or payment plans. This ensures 100% of your intended donation amount goes to the organization.
